Aero India 2021: 45 MSMEs have bagged orders worth Rs 203 crore, says Defence Minister Rajnath Singh

Addressing the `Startup Manthan` at Aero India 2021, Defence Minister said, "We have signed 128 MoUs, 19 ToTs, 4 Handing Overs, 18 Product Launches and 32 major announcements, totalling a grand figure of 201 feats. Further, 45 MSMEs participating in Aero India 2021 have bagged orders worth Rs 203 crore. This is a major achievement."

India ready to supply weapons systems to countries in Indian Ocean Region: Defence Minister Rajnath Singh

Rajnath Singh said that organising a conclave of countries in the IOR on the margins of the international event "Aero India-2021" shows the importance India attaches to the vision of common growth and stability and constructive engagements with them.

Seen through geo-strategic prism, India is central to peace, stability and security in this region: IAF Chief RKS Bhadauria

The IAF Chief also said, "Today we have this seamless air space surveillance capability across the entire air space and this has been done indigenously with our own industry. India and the IAF are conscious of responsibility shared with our friends and partners in responding to calls for assistance in wake of natural disasters and calamities."

Aero India 2021 kicks off in Bengaluru; Rajnath Singh says it will spark a renewed sense of pride in defence sector

The Union Defence Minister, Rajnath Singh, on Tuesday (February 2) revealed that the Aero India will give a boost to the Aatmanirbhar Bharat scheme as over 200 agreements are expected to be signed on the last day of the show on February 5.

Aero India 2021 will help transform world’s largest democracy into most powerful defence economy: Rajnath Singh

Union Defence Minister Rajnath Singh addressed the ‘Curtain Raiser Event’ for Aero India show. Singh said, "The Aero India 2021, will help forge enormous global engagement with Indian defence industry, in the form of partnerships and investments, paving the path for a transformation of the world’s largest democracy into the world’s most powerful defence economy."
